Autopilot / Guidance Engineer
The Principal Engineer / Sr. Principal Engineer will design, develop, implement, verify, and test high-quality software and simulation toolchains. The candidate will be working on a 6 degree of freedom (6DOF) simulation to design and test missile flight code. The applicant will be creating and implementing 6DoF simulation models to evaluate system performance. The candidate should have extensive experience with missile flight dynamics, autopilot and guidance design and implementation into the missile flight code. The candidate should have a strong background in autopilot design/development and be able to mentor early career engineers.
This position may be offered at the Principal Engineer GNC Level 3 or Sr. Principal Engineer GNC Level 4.
Principal Engineer GNC Level 3 - 5 Years with Bachelors in Science; 3 Years with Masters; 1 Year with PhD
